Transaction 62f31023d265eef38a1d00320e85e669a9326e042240e243e1afd6d4a34b3de8
1 Input
1 Output
-
62f31023d265eef38a1d00320e85e669a9326e042240e243e1afd6d4a34b3de8:0
- value
- 15803630
- script pubkey
- OP_0 OP_PUSHBYTES_20 d14927c3bb5f0fd12b76352042c58ac00c609ee9
- address
- bc1q69yj0samtu8az2mkx5sy93v2cqxxp8hfj3ean8